It can take a bit of practice to get comfy establishing your camping tent, particularly if you have a new tent or it's been a while because you last pitched. Practicing at home provides a low-stress, low-pressure environment to find out the throwing procedure and to supply your camping tent parts before you go out on your journey.
Begin by reading your tent's instructions and outlining all the parts. Discover where each part connects, how to connect the posts and just how to elevate your camping tent. Some camping tents have color-coded or numbered pole areas, which suit matching sleeves or clips at the corners of your outdoor tents.
You will certainly likewise wish to set up your tent impact or tarpaulin, which will certainly shield your outdoor tents flooring from the aspects and help prevent moisture. Lastly, situate the most effective area to pitch your outdoor tents at your camp site to reduce effect and to optimize satisfaction of your camping site's environments.
Exercise Pitching
Ideally, you want to understand pitching your outdoor tents in the house before you head out on the route. Finding out to set up your tent while you're out in the components and tired from a day of hiking is a recipe for stress, complication and potentially damaged or damaged tent components.
Method setting up your outdoor tents while adhering to the particular instructions for your details camping tent model, taking into account the surface and weather conditions you will certainly come across on camping journeys. For example, if you plan to camp in windy problems, secure the edges of your camping tent early on to stay clear of having them blow around while you continue to set up the remainder of the shelter.
Also, make sure to take notice of the placement of risks in your camping tent impact or tarpaulin. You want the risks to be placed up and down to offer stability, however not so far that they posture a trip threat or are subjected to water.

Once you get to the campground, laying out your camping tent will go much quicker if you take the time to choose the best place for it. Look for level ground that's free of significant bumps, rocks, and debris. Orient your outdoor tents away from reduced areas that gather rain and avoid places near tree branches that could fall on you throughout stormy weather.
After that outlined a ground tarp (your camping tent's "impact"), which safeguards the flooring of your shelter and includes an added layer of comfort. Make certain the footprint is huge enough to fit your camping tent and any other equipment you prepare to bring with you.
After that set up your outdoor tents poles, which begin folded up and held together by shock cord threaded via them. Unfold them and place completions into sleeves or clips in the edges of your tent. Consult your camping tent's user's manuals for comprehensive details on how to do this. Dry your camping tent prior to stuffing it back into its things sack; moisture left on a camping tent does damages.
